- 博客(19)
- 资源 (3)
- 收藏
- 关注
原创 C# 程序自动重启的解决方法
很多时候,我们有这样的场景,需要让程序自动重启,有很多种方法,比如用微软自带提供的方法,或者自己开辟新的线程重新调用。下面简单介绍两种方法。
2022-06-16 10:23:58
836
原创 SQL SERVER或者Oracle 数据库插入平方(²)立方(³)等特殊字符
SQL SERVER或者Oracle 数据库插入平方(²)立方(³)等特殊字符最近遇到一个奇葩的问题,客户非要保存20²,50³等这样的数据,但是到了数据库就变成202,503了最后解决办法是:1, varchar 类型改成nvarchar,在插入的时候就可以了2.如果是更新update语句,值前加 N ,标识字符,如:update table1 t set t.bz = N’m³’...
2022-05-11 09:02:06
2364
1
原创 mui.js label radio 不能选中问题
很多手机端的组件使用了mui的一些方法,如果要引用相关组件的话 就必须要引用mui.js,但存在BUG,现象如下:点击label时,并不能选中单选框。原因是,mui.js中做了禁止的操作。查了网上的给出的答案,总是抄来抄去,实际测试并不能起作用。综合判断 mui应该是重写了相关事件来实现点击label文字来选中label里面的单选框功能,但是没有考虑到一个div中有多个label的情况,默认选中的是第一个label下面的radio经过本分亲自测试,研究出如下两种方案:方案1:如果页面不需要mu
2022-01-14 10:51:44
505
1
原创 将list集合转化为sql in 的范围对象
将list集合转化为sql in 的范围对象 比如List idList= new List();idList.Add(“001”);idList.Add(“002”);idList.Add(“003”);select * from table where id in (‘001’,‘002’,‘001’)/// /// 将list集合转化为sql in 的范围对象/// /// /// public static string transGuidListToSqlString(L
2022-01-14 10:26:50
4381
2
转载 2021-03-02
Winform中实现子窗体刷新父窗体首先我们看到是一个父窗体接下来是子窗体展示,当我们点击取消或者关闭按钮时,我们需要看到我们添加或者修改的数据能展示出来,这就是我们要做的事代码部分:首先是子窗体中的代码,我们需要定义一个委托和事件//定义委托public delegate void Refresh();//定义事件public event Refresh myRefresh;其次是父窗体的代码,我们需要定义一个刷新的方法/// /// 刷新控件信息/// /// PengZhen
2021-03-02 11:11:13
94
原创 获取本地的外网IP地址
获取本地的外网IP地址 /// <summary> /// 功能:获取本地的外网IP地址 /// </summary> /// <returns></returns> private static string GetPublicIp() { var urlList = new List<string> { "http://www.ip138.c
2021-01-29 10:19:27
346
原创 win7系统配置jdk环境变量运行javac命令报错解决办法
最近学习java,安装eclipse,必须给电脑安装jdk,关于64位系统下jdk环境变量的配置。按照网上的配置环境变量教程3步走:“计算机”->右键“属性”->“高级系统设置”->“环境变量”,在系统变量里:1.新建变量名JAVA_HOME,值是jdk的安装目录,如:C:\Program Files\Java\jdk1.8.0_121;2.新建变量名CLASS_PATH,值是:.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ar;(最前面有一点
2020-07-06 09:08:42
1701
原创 js将数字转换成千分位格式,以及去除千分位格式
//转换成带千分位格式 function formatNumber(s) { if (!isNaN(s)) { s = $.trim(s + ""); var l = s.split(".")[0].split("").reverse(), r = s.indexOf(".") >= 0 ? "." + s.split(".")[1] : ""; ...
2020-05-13 14:15:15
745
原创 自定义转化不同时间格式
// <summary> /// 时间转化为string:精度到天 /// </summary> /// <param name="obj"></param> /// <returns></returns> public static string DateTimeFormatString(Object _Object, int FormatType) { stri...
2020-05-12 16:17:39
185
原创 小数点后面保留2位有效数字(保留小数点后面不为0的2位小数)
/// <summary> /// 保留两位有效数字,而不是2位小数 /// </summary> /// <param name="DNumber"></param> /// <returns></returns> private string ConvertNumber(double DNumber) { int EffectiveC...
2020-05-12 16:07:17
3802
原创 C# DataTable去除重复的2种方式
sourceDT是获取到的一个DataTable类型的集合对象去重复使用方式:实例化一个DataView对象为dv,直接dv.ToTable()即可,ToTable中可为(true,“用于判断重复的列”),如图中所示,需要注意的是此处用于判断的列,几个,在新的表中就出现几个...
2020-04-22 10:07:50
5410
原创 C# 类似xxx|xxxxxxx,根据多个符号拆分字符串并放入Dictionary,把Dictionary转换成DataTable
Dictionary<string, string> dictionary = new Dictionary<string, string>(); string vs = "1,a|2,b|3,c|4,d|5,e|,|"; dictionary = vs.Split(new string[] { "," }, StringS...
2019-11-28 16:07:14
665
原创 C# 删除清空文件夹及拷贝文件夹下面的内容
C# 删除清空文件夹及拷贝文件夹下面的内容的方法直接调用就行,只要参数传的对,一定可以成功拷贝文件及文件夹 /// <summary> /// 拷贝文件及文件夹 /// </summary> /// <param name="srcPath">源文件</param> /// <param name="...
2019-10-18 10:21:34
492
原创 C#按日期生成文件夹,并在文件夹中写入文件的方法
C#按日期生成文件夹,并在文件夹中写入文件的方法,直接调用就可以 /// <summary> /// 创建日志文件 /// </summary> /// <param name="contents">日志内容</param> private void TxtLog(string contents) {...
2019-10-18 10:14:56
3161
C# 带进度条的批量压缩解压文件,zip格式;还可以一键上传到远程服务器的指定目录下
2022-11-15
C#发送邮件源码带邮箱格式校验
2022-06-01
baiduVoice.rar
2019-10-31
BaiduOcrWinform.rar
2019-08-08
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人